Jack Yates...  My God...  Those kids can play.

They have a guard who simply jumps out of the gym...  They have a point that the coach has all confidence in. They have a little rainbow shooter... They have a little speedster.... They can all mix you up and break your ankles.  Even the 6'10" small forward (3 pt. shooter) that they start at Center.  These guys will be hard to beat.  

As for the game... simply exciting.  Good basketball and it was very sound basketball. Dunking, shooting and good d!  Yates took the lead in the 3rd quater again then played sound ball to get the win.  With all that said... Ozen don't be intimidated you have the guard play to play with these guys and the coach to do it.  Those National teams have never seen a team that will press and run the entire game and they played right into that tempo... Boutte will slow this down.  Yates and Ozen will be a good game.  Watch out for Smiley they are big and athletic... the entire bench is small though.  They start two wings at 6'7 and three guards at 6'3, 6'4, and 5'10.

WB... 5A is loaded...  Kingwood will not be a pushover...  Best defense I saw and the play sound and mistake free.  Madison is good but if you stop Tommy Mason-Griffin they can be beat, run two men at him and play #30 close nobody else will step up.  Cy-Springs can flat out play... They beat Yates by 1.  Hastings can play with anyone. Klien collins is talented glad they moved the Klien teams out of this region.
